Detailed explanation-1: -Physical geography (also known as physiography) is one of the three main branches of geography. Physical geography is the branch of natural science which deals with the processes and patterns in the natural environment such as the atmosphere, hydrosphere, biosphere, and geosphere.

Detailed explanation-2: -Physical geography is the study of Earth’s seasons, climate, atmosphere, soil, streams, landforms, and oceans.

Detailed explanation-3: -Physical geography deals with studying the processes of and natural features on Earth. Some examples of physical characteristics in geography are landforms, soil, weather, climate, and plant and animal life. Geographers examine these features as well as how they interact with each other and with humans.

Detailed explanation-4: -Physical geography encompasses the study of the land, oceans, seasons, climate, atmosphere, and Earth’s soil. It looks at how these elements change and have changed over time, the spatial relationships they have with shaping current environments.

Detailed explanation-5: -Geography is the spatial study of the earth’s physical and cultural environments. Geographers study the earth’s physical characteristics, its inhabitants and cultures, phenomena such as climate, and the earth’s place within the universe.
